Tonight at Night of Champions the historic Women's Championship and the short lived Divas Championship will say goodbye, and for the first time in WWE history we will have a Unified Divas Title. Either Melina or Michelle McCool will walk ...

With the recent announcement that Tara is on her way out of TNA, along with the departure of Awesome Kong and rumored unhappiness of Taylor Wilde, it seems that TNA is in trouble when it comes to the Knockouts. With the recent storylines involving the Tag Titles and the Knockouts Title itself, I'd say the women have something to complain about. It was not that long ago when it seemed TNA was doing something the WWE doesn't: using the girls, and using them right. It was then, as it is now, that the TNA Knockouts are a ratings draw, and are often ...
